Key Differences

Altitude Comparison

The altitude gap here is significant. Bara Bhangal takes you 2,250ft higher than Annapurna Base Camp — expect meaningfully harder breathing, a slower pace on the upper section, and a real difference in AMS risk between the two.

Experience Required

Both require prior experience, but Bara Bhangal scores 33 difficulty points higher. If you're building progressively, Annapurna Base Camp is the better starting point.

Cost Comparison

Bara Bhangal starts lower at budget tier (₹15,000 – ₹30,000) vs Annapurna Base Camp (₹25,000 - ₹35,000). The gap at entry level is ₹10,000 — meaningful if you're cost-sensitive.

Better for: Bara Bhangal

Terrain Steepness

Don't just look at the difficulty rating. Bara Bhangal Trek features punishing climbs with a max gradient of 50%, posing a significant challenge to knees. Annapurna Base Camp Trek is much more forgiving with a gentler 30% max gradient.

Better for: Annapurna Base Camp

Family & Comfort

Annapurna Base Camp Trek is a better option for younger families, allowing children from age 8, compared to Bara Bhangal Trek which has a minimum age of 18.

Better for: Annapurna Base Camp

Crowd & Atmosphere

Annapurna Base Camp Trek: peaceful Bara Bhangal Trek: isolated. Stargazing: Bara Bhangal Trek has a darker sky (Bortle 1 vs 2) — a meaningful difference on a clear night.

Gear Rental

Annapurna Base Camp Trek has gear rental available (Pokhara) — useful if you're not travelling with full kit. Bara Bhangal Trek has no rental option at base; bring all equipment from a city like Rishikesh or Manali.

Better for: Annapurna Base Camp

Digital Detox vs. Connected

Bara Bhangal Trek offers WiFi availability at the basecamp, allowing you to check in with family or work. Annapurna Base Camp Trek is a complete digital detox with zero connectivity.
